Are you a detail-oriented professional with a passion for accuracy and security? As a Vault Teller, you’ll play a critical role in managing cash operations, balancing vault transactions, and ensuring branch efficiency. You’ll work closely with the branch team, maintain compliance with vault procedures, and provide exceptional service by identifying financial opportunities for our members. If you thrive in a fast-paced environment, have strong cash-handling experience, and enjoy contributing to a team’s success, we’d love to have you on board!

The Opportunity: Our Livonia branch is seeking a full time Vault Teller to join their team.

What You’ll Do:
Balance vault and branch transactions.
Compliance with established vault processes.
Maintain branch operations log book and associated tasks.
Open cash box daily and work on the cash line.
Meet personal sales goals.
Approve transactions as authorized.
Assist co-workers with transactions and procedures, as requested.
Complete daily work accurately and in a timely manner.
Make decisions, when necessary, according to policy and procedure and within approved limit.
Provide superior service to members by actively promoting and communicating financial opportunities.
Refer interested members while maintaining quality standards.
Assist in the efficient operation of the cash area.
Maintain product knowledge to efficiently serve members.
Keep current on individual and team sales and service results.
Participate in the Branch Team Development program.
Support the organizational goals and values.
Saturday hours required.
Flexible work schedule; ability and willingness to work at any one of our branch offices.
Additional meeting and training times required; travel may be required.
What You'll Need:
High school diploma, or equivalent.
One year goal driven sales experience in a financial or retail environment.
Two years cash handling experience in a financial institution, preferred.
Financial institution vault experience required.
Exceptional analytical and problem-solving skills.
Excellent interpersonal skills including effective verbal and written communication.
Ability to move or lift up to 50 lbs., usually coin.
Computer literate.
Consistent positive, cooperative, self-motivated, courteous and professional attitude.
Demonstrated ability to multitask.
Demonstrated ability to function as a team player.
Ability to perform with minimum supervision.
